还剩1页未读,继续阅读
文本内容:
轻松掌握Python应用开发,编写创新应用程序Python是一种流行的高级编程语言,因其简单易用、灵活性强、容易学习和快速开发等特点而备受欢迎,特别是在Web开发、数据分析、人工智能等领域得到广泛应用Python的优雅语法以及强大和智能的内置函数,可以使开发者轻松创建创新和强大的应用程序,本文将介绍一些方法和技巧,以帮助您轻松掌握Python应用开发和编写创新的应用程序I.了解Python语言基础知识首先,想要轻松掌握Python应用开发,你需要了解Python语言的基础知识Python是一种解释性语言,它非常适合快速开发它有一个清晰和简单的语法,其中包括各种数据类型,比如数字,字符串和列表Python的面向对象编程(OOP)是其受欢迎的一个原因,其中类和对象可用于创建可重用的和模块化的代码其他重要的Python概念包括函数、模块和包等II.学习Python开发环境Python有多个开发环境,其中包括IDLE,PyCharm和JupyterNotebook等常用的IDE这些IDE可以使你轻松地编写、调试和测试代码在选择开发环境时,你需要考虑你的编程经验、你的需求和你的预算IDLE是Python官方自带的IDE,简单易用,非常适合Python初学者;PyCharm是一款强大的、高效的、跨平台的PythonIDE,它配备了各种工具和插件,可用于Web开发、数据分析和科学计算等各种用途;JupyterNotebook是一种基于浏览器的所见即所得(WYSIWYG)编辑器,它支持Python、R和其他多种编程语言,非常适合数据分析和可视化选择合适的开发环境是Python应用开发的重要一步III.掌握Python中的数据科学和Web开发Python在Web开发和数据分析领域得到广泛应用,因此,你需要掌握Python中的相关工具和技术在数据科学方面,Python提供了各种库和工具,包括NumPy、Pandas、Matplotlib和SciPy等,可用于数据处理、分析和可视化还有一些流行的深度学习框架,如TensorFlow、Keras和Pytorch,可用于机器学习和人工智能在Web开发方面,Python提供了各种框架和库,如Django、Flask、Pyramid和Tornado等,可用于Web应用程序的开发和部署你需要了解这些工具和框架的基础知识,并熟悉如何使用它们来编写创新的应用程序IV.学习Python中的数据库Python中有很多库可用于与各种数据库进行交互,包括MySQL、PostgreSQL、MongoDB和SQLite等学习如何连接和交互数据库是重要的,因为大多数应用程序都需要访问和操作数据在Python中,你可以使用SQLAlchemy等ORM库,也可以使用原生的SQL语句了解这些库的使用和关系型和非关系型数据库的区别将为你创建更强大的应用程序提供帮助V.参与社区Python拥有一个庞大的全球社区,其中包含各种会议、活动、项目和开源软件参与Python社区可以帮助你连接其他开发者,了解最新的技术和工具,以及获得支持和帮助在社区中,你可以发表文章、提交代码、回答问题、创建项目和组织活动等在Python社区中,有许多优秀的开发者都会分享自己的经验和知识,所以你可以从他们那里获得宝贵的建议和指导VI.代码审查和测试代码测试和审查是Python应用开发中很重要的一步测试可以帮助你检查代码是否按预期工作,并确保它们符合应用程序的需求在Python中,你可以使用unittest等测试框架来编写测试,也可以使用Pytest等第三方库来管理和运行测试用例代码审查可以帮助你识别代码中的潜在问题,并确保高质量的代码这些技术可从事业余爱好者到大型企业的所有开发者和小组应用结论总之,Python是一种灵活、强大、简单且易学的编程语言,它提供了各种工具和库,以帮助开发人员在各种领域中创建创新和强大的应用程序要轻松掌握Python应用开发,你需要了解Python的基本知识,掌握开发环境、数据科学和Web应用程序开发、数据库、社区和代码审查和测试等方面的技术,同时交流和分享,不断学习、积累经验和创造自己的想法Python应用开发是一个充满挑战和机会的领域,你可以接受这个挑战并借助现代技术实现你的梦想第PAGE页共NUMPAGES页。
个人认证
优秀文档
获得点赞 0